Around 3:00 a.m. on April 25, 1990, as she was driving to actor Michael Miu Kiu Wai’s home, four men in another vehicle tailed her car. When Lau arrived at the destination's parking lot and was waiting for the gate to open, the men forced her car to crash into the barrier. They then jumped out, broke open her car door with tools, cut her seatbelt with a knife, and dragged her into their vehicle before speeding away. on April 25
